topsoil 2,498 Posted August 29, 2021 Decent meeting. Some good racing, if not a lot of passing. Some heats with two races in one. For a challenge / friendly it was what you expected. The riders had fun and you could tell there is a bond between them all, as witnessed by the number of times cut out chains were pulled after the races finished. It could have been easy for the promotion to say 'tough' after the Eastbourne matches were called off and the season tickets holders would have lost out on two matches. But credit where it is due, they looked after their customers. New format for the racing, where you could give four of your team an extra ride somewhere. It was different. Gives team managers something to think about. Only positives came out of last night. 1 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
